How much extra strength is an attack given if it is your pokemon's type?

May. 1, 2010



I believe that I was once informed that if you are using a move that is the same type as your pokemon, it is stronger. (Ex: Vaporeon using surf (special attack, power 95) is stronger than Vaporeon using ice beam (special attack, power 95). If anyone could verify this, I would apriciate it. If it is true, how much does it improve the move? Thank you.

What you are talking about is STAB (Same Type Attack Bonus)With STAB you get a 1.5 multiplier.
